Elizabeth Ellen Elrod Vickers Bridges, a resident of Talking Rock, Georgia, gained her heavenly home on July 15, 2026, at Northside Cherokee Hospital in Canton, Georgia.

Born in Nashville, Tennessee, Elizabeth lived a life marked by gratitude, kindness, compassion, and a deep desire to care for others as well as God’s beautiful creation, especially animals. She loved the Lord with all her heart and faithfully demonstrated that love through fervent prayer, studying His Word, and singing hymns of praise. She was a devoted prayer warrior for her family and friends. Many mornings and evenings could find her sitting on the prayer rock along the mountain trail behind her home, faithfully bringing the cares of others before the throne of God.

Elizabeth touched countless lives both personally and professionally. She proudly served as a police officer with the Huntsville Police Department in Huntsville, Alabama, faithfully serving and protecting her community. After moving to Georgia, she worked as an interior designer and decorator in Marietta alongside her husband in his contracting business.

Her compassionate heart also led her to become involved with Rescue Ranch and its thrift store in Jasper, where she found great joy in helping animals and adopting several beloved fur babies of her own.

In her later years, Elizabeth discovered a passion for art, becoming a self-taught oil painter on canvas and rock. She especially loved creating mushroom and angel paintings, selling some of her artwork but more often giving it as treasured gifts to family, friends, and neighbors. She also enjoyed digging for ginseng, searching for morel mushrooms, and traveling to admire God’s breathtaking handiwork in the mountains, by the sea, and beneath beautiful, cloud-filled skies.

Elizabeth will be remembered for her warm smile, cheerful spirit, joyful laughter, quick wit, and sharp mind. Her unwavering faith, generous heart, and the many stories she shared will continue to live on in the hearts of all who were blessed to know and love her.

A Memorial Celebration of Life will be held on Saturday, August 15, 2026, at 2:00 p.m. at Baggett’s Chapel on Highway 13 in Cunningham, Tennessee, with Greg McGuigan officiating. Burial will follow at Fletcher Cemetery in Erin, Tennessee.

Elizabeth is survived by her sons, John Hill Vickers Jr., Terry Vickers, Troy Vickers, all of Huntsville, Alabama, and Andrew Bridges of Jasper, Georgia; her daughter, Deane M. Hutchinson of Florida; her sister, Kathye Jackson of Tennessee; numerous grandchildren, great-grandchildren, and great-great-grandchildren; nieces and nephews; and her beloved fur children.

Care of Elizabeth has been entrusted to In Their Honor Funeral and Cremation Providers.
